* @copyright 2011-2026 Nicola Asuni - Tecnick.com LTD * @license https://www.gnu.org/copyleft/lesser.html GNU-LGPL v3 (see LICENSE) * @link https://github.com/tecnickcom/tc-lib-pdf-image * * This file is part of tc-lib-pdf-image software library. */ namespace Com\Tecnick\Pdf\Image; /** * Com\Tecnick\Pdf\Image\ImageCacheInterface * * Optional external cache used to persist processed image data across * Import instances and PHP processes, avoiding recomputation of images that * have already been imported, resized and encoded. * * Implementations are a thin bridge to any backend (filesystem, APCu, Redis, * a PSR-16 cache, ...). They only need to store and retrieve plain arrays; * (de)serialization and eviction are the backend's responsibility. * * The cached value is the import-time snapshot of an image: it never contains * PDF object numbers (those are assigned per document at output time). Both * methods MUST be best-effort and MUST NOT throw on a backend miss or * transient backend failure, so that a cache problem never breaks PDF * generation. * * Security: the cache store is a trust boundary. The stored arrays (image * data, palette and ICC bytes) are embedded verbatim into generated PDFs, so * anyone able to write to the backend can influence document output. Use a * store only your application can write to, and when an implementation * deserializes data it MUST disable object restoration * (e.g. unserialize($s, ['allowed_classes' => false])). * * @since 2026-06-16 * @category Library * @package PdfImage * @author Nicola Asuni * @copyright 2011-2026 Nicola Asuni - Tecnick.com LTD * @license https://www.gnu.org/copyleft/lesser.html GNU-LGPL v3 (see LICENSE) * @link https://github.com/tecnickcom/tc-lib-pdf-image * * @phpstan-import-type ImageRawData from \Com\Tecnick\Pdf\Image\Import */ interface ImageCacheInterface { /** * Retrieve a previously stored image data array. * * @param string $key Image cache key. * * @return ImageRawData|null Stored image data array, or null on a miss. */ public function get(string $key): ?array; /** * Store an image data array. * * @param string $key Image cache key. * @param ImageRawData $data Image data array to store. */ public function set(string $key, array $data): void; }
